This process is known as weathering, where the rock is broken down by a combination of physical, chemical, and biological processes. These processes can include erosion, freeze-thaw cycles, root growth, and oxidation, which gradually break the rock into smaller pieces.
The C Horizon contains large pieces of broken up bedrock. It is the layer of weathered parent material that lies below the A and E horizons in soil profiles.

The regolith horizon contains large pieces of broken up bedrock. This horizon is composed of fragmented rock material that has undergone weathering processes, making it looser and more fragmented than the underlying unweathered bedrock.
The Earth's surface is broken into large pieces called tectonic plates. These plates float on the semi-fluid asthenosphere layer beneath them and interact at plate boundaries, where geological phenomena such as earthquakes and volcanic eruptions occur.

Small pieces of rock from old broken-up comets become meteoroids when they enter Earth's atmosphere. Depending on their size, they can create meteors (shooting stars) as they burn up or meteorites if they survive the journey to the surface of the Earth.

The process of breaking down large masses of rock into smaller pieces is called weathering. This can occur through physical, chemical, or biological processes. Physical weathering involves the mechanical breakdown of rocks, while chemical weathering alters the minerals within the rocks. Together, these processes contribute to the formation of soil and sediment.
